What are the mind boosting foods?

Mind boosting foods contain a lot of nutrients that are good for the brain’s health. Vitamins, omega-3 fatty acids, protein and fibre, heal the damaged cells and promote the growth of new brain cells.

Here are some of the best foods that can help to improve brain health, memory and concentration:

Vegetables

Vegetables like Green broccoli, spinach, kale, celery, carrots, and peppers contain many fibre and essential nutrients that can help the brain grow. For example, one bowl of broccoli can provide the daily amount of vitamin K, which helps to boost brain memory and focus.

Fruits

Sweet fruits like Avocados, blueberries, strawberries, kiwi, oranges, tomatoes, and grapes contain those detoxifying vitamins that help the brain fight the free radicals that cause damage in the brain veins. Avocados and blueberries deliver concentrated amounts of vitamins B, C and K and help to promote the production of brain cells in the part of your brain responsible for memory. 

Dry Fruits

The less moisture dry fruits like apricot, walnuts, almonds, and pistachios contain less vitamin C. Still, they are packed with many fibres, calcium, potassium and copper that our body needs. In addition, the concentrated nutrients in dry fruits help to heal the damaged brain cells.

Eggs

Eggs are a good source of B vitamins and protein. In addition, eggs’ antioxidant properties help slow down the progression of mental decline.

Whole grains

The fibre in whole grains helps deal with inflammation, fights the oxidative stress caused by free radicals, and prevents vascular damage. Entire grains like Wild rice, barley, corn, oats, quinoa, rye, wheat are the best for the brain. 

Fish

The omega-3 fatty acids in fish like salmon, tuna, and trout help transmit neurons’ function. Fish also helps improve the brain’s ability to process information quickly. The human body doesn’t produce omega-3 fatty acids on its own, but to enhance brain health, you can eat fish two times per week.

Nuts and seeds

Seeds and nuts like walnuts, sunflower seeds, pumpkin seeds, chia, flax, and almonds contain many essential nutrients like iron, magnesium, zinc and copper that helps to improve the signals of nerves and aid brain memory. These nuts and seeds can also help to relax the mind.

Dark chocolate

Chocolate – with at least 70 per cent cocoa – reduces inflammation, boosts mood and contains flavonoids that help memory.

Spices

Spices such as turmeric, rosemary, sage, thyme do wonder for brain health. These spices help the cells grow and reduce the risk of deadly Alzheimer’s disease.
